The text presents a structured exploration of philosophical concepts, focusing on the interpretations of "and." It begins with an introduction that outlines the problem and objectives of the investigation, followed by a logical and visual categorization system. The first part uses Plato's Parmenides as a guide, discussing various interpretations and the concepts of unity and the other in different positions. The second part delves into the aporetic nature of unity and multiplicity, examining antinomies related to unity—both absolute and total—and the concept of extension, distinguishing between continuum and form. The third part addresses movement as a twofold unity, reflecting on the requirements of the mediating principle and its manifestations in quantitative (local movement), qualitative (change), relational (becoming), and epistemic (consciousness) forms. The annotation concludes with references, an index of persons, and a subject index, encapsulating a comprehensive philosophical inquiry into the nature of unity, multiplicity, and movement.
